A Merged set takes the concept of saving space to the extreme. In this format, the parent and all of its clones are combined into a single ZIP file (usually named after the parent). Inside the archive, you will find the ROM sets for numerous variations of the game all together. This is very efficient for storage but can be cumbersome if you only want a specific clone, as you have to keep the massive merged file regardless.
